MERI DURGA: Parineeta Borthakur OUT and Dolly Sohi IN from the show

TV actress Parineeta Borthakur gets replaced

New Delhi: Star Plus show ‘Meri Durga’ saw a huge leap in the story and many new faces were introduced in the show. TV actress Parineeta Borthakur, who was last seen Colors TV show ‘Swaragini’ was roped in to play grey character in ‘Meri Durga’. But now we have heard that actress is quitting the show. Makers decided to get Dolly Sohi to play the role of ‘Gayatri Devi’. Feature IMG-20170802-WA0012 IMG-20170802-WA0010 When we contacted Parineeta asking about the replacement, she said, “I had to rush to my family due to some emergency and I won't be able to shoot for the next one week. I understand that they have to telecast so we mutually agreed on the replacement.” Well, we hope everything is fine in Parineeta’s family. On the other hand talking to us, Dolly Sohi said, “I am excited to be part of ‘Meri Durga’ and it’s a bit Grey shade which I think I am playing after long time. I accepted the role as it was challenging. Just hope to get some new experiences.
